Subject: Re: [PATCH net 0/2] vsock/virtio: fix MSG_PEEK calculation on bytes to copy
Date: Mon, 15 Jun 2026 15:48:35 -0400 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20260615154828-mutt-send-email-mst@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260402-fix_peek-v1-0-ad274fcef77b@redhat.com>
On Thu, Apr 02, 2026 at 10:18:00AM +0200, Luigi Leonardi wrote:
> `virtio_transport_stream_do_peek`, when calculating the number of bytes to copy,
> didn't consider the `offset`, caused by partial reads that happend before.
> This might cause out-of-bounds read that lead to an EFAULT.
> More details in the commit.
>
> Commit 1 introduces the fix
> Commit 2 introduces a test that checks for this bug to avoid future
> regressions.
